American Restaurants in St. Petersburg
Defining American cuisine can be an almost impossible task, but identifying the best St. Petersburg American restaurants is thankfully a much easier endeavor. Whether you’re craving the perfectly cooked petit filet or a gourmet version of your favorite macaroni and cheese, look no further than the St. Petersburg American restaurants which have everything to satiate even the pickiest palettes. After all, there’s a lot more to American cuisine than just apple pie!
Filter
1
4506 Gulf Blvd
St Pete Beach
FL
33706
2
6000 Gulf Blvd
St Pete Beach
FL
33706
6
12000 Gulf Blvd
Treasure Island
FL
33706
7
11333 Us Highway 19
Clearwater
FL
33764
8
6638 4th St N
St Petersburg
FL
33702
9
1201 Gulf Blvd
Clearwater Beach
FL
33767
10
22950 US Highway 19 North
Clearwater
FL
33765
Don't see the business you're looking for? Add it here
American Restaurants by St. Petersburg Neighborhoods
- Clearwater Beach
- Clearwater
- Largo
- Palm Harbor
- Pinellas Park
- Spring Hill
- Seminole
- Saint Pete Beach
- St Pete Beach
- Peninsula Suburbs & North
- St. Petersburg
- Downtown
- Old Bayside / Marina
- Carver City - Lincoln Gardens
- Tampa
- Bradenton
- Brandon
- Citrus Park
- Lakeland
- Riverview
- Sarasota
- Town N Country
- Wesley Chapel
- Carver City
- Tampa International Airport Area
- Saint Petersburg
© 2025 StPetersburg.com: A City Guide by Boulevards. All Rights Reserved. Advertise with us | Contact us | Privacy Policy | Terms of Use | Site Map